  • This video was recorded to assist new machine owners. In this video, I show you how to use built in videos to aid you in winding bobbins, thread your machine, change needles and presser feet.

  • @arleneolson5258
    @arleneolson5258 4 года назад +1

    My dealer recommends to only wind bobbins at half speed, never faster. Full speed can pull the thread too tight and wind unevenly.

    • @terrymaffitt4012
      @terrymaffitt4012  4 года назад

      Arlene Olson - I was told half speed would increase the amount of thread on the bobbin. Truthfully, I cannot see a distinct difference either way. My bobbins wind fairly evenly.
